The advanced anti-dust technology features dust free glass and a short edge frame design without an A surface, reducing dust and snow accumulation on the module surface while improving light capture and overall power generation efficiency. . Anti-dust modules and anti-soiling solar panel coatings are not new, but LONGi's research and testing indicated that more could be done. The “ 2022 LONGi Global Customer Satisfaction Survey Report ” shows that 80. 13% of residential and C&I scenarios are troubled by module dust accumulation. . Solar module racks and mounts hold solar panels in place on a roof, on a building facade, or in a ground-based array of panels. Mounts safely secure a full array. Solar energy, which researchers say offers much potential to meet the Democratic Republic of Congo's energy needs, remains largely unaffordable and out of reach for Indigenous Batwa people and rural residents. A literature review that examines the fire safety implications of installing photovoltaic (PV) systems, reviewing experimental evidence, incident data and existing regulatory approaches. . Photovoltaic (PV) panels can be retrofitted on buildings after construction or can be used to replace conventional building materials used for roofs, walls or facades.
